On Sun, Jun 24, 2012 at 6:38 PM, Vadim Girlin <vadimgir...@gmail.com> wrote: > On Sun, 2012-06-24 at 17:43 +0200, Marek Olšák wrote: >> Hi Vadim, >> >> This is: >> >> Reviewed-by: Marek Olšák <mar...@gmail.com> >> >> I'd like to point out an issue here, which has nothing to do with your >> patch, just so you know. >> >> Flushing in create_sampler_view is wrong. Some people have been >> wondering why depth flushes are not realiable while there is such >> an obvious mistake right in front of them. create_sampler_view has >> nothing to do with rendering. The only thing we know for sure is that >> create_sampler_view is called sometime before the sampler view is used >> (obviously), but it can be called anytime, even at context creation. >> The correct place where the depth buffer should be flushed is >> set_*_sampler_views (or anytime before the next drawing operation). >> > > Hi, Marek, > > If I'm not missing something, depth flushing is already implemented as > you said - we're just creating the texture for flushed depth in the > create_sampler_view, and real flush is performed in the > r600_update_derived_state. Though I suspect there is a problem with this > patch if flushed depth texture is reallocated after creating sampler > view state, because sampler view is not updated then.
